HDMI output not supported?
Hi, I recently bought a T.V. from a relative. First attempt to connect my laptop to it through HDMI, my laptop screen goes black and the T.V. reads "Not supported". I unplugged the HDMI, the laptop screen remained black and could only be fixed with a hard reboot.
No progress has been made, however I've started to pinpoint where the issue lies by testing some things out:
I have had my friend plug his laptop into the T.V, that worked fine, so the only possible issue with the T.V. is simply outdated compatibilities, yet a newer laptop should be able to display something that an older t.v. could recognize.
I have tried using win+p a few times to change the display mode before connecting the HDMI cable into the laptop.
I have tried my laptop on my friends monitor, it worked immediately without having to change any settings.
I believe the main issue is in the way my laptop is sending display info to the T.V, possibly the resolution or screen refresh rate? However, it is incredibly difficult for me to troubleshoot this without any help from someone with experience in this field as my screen goes entirely black as soon as I connect the HDMI cable.
I've done some googling, people seem to have similar problems but I've yet to find an answer that works for me.
